Australia spinners Adam Zampa and Ashton Agar led the way after a resilient batting performance as the visitors stunned Rohit Sharma and co. in the series deciding third and final one-dayer in Chennai to register a rare series win in India. It was India’s first series defeat at home since they went down 2-3 against Australia in March 2019. In between, India played 7 ODI series at home and had won each one of them.
